School Parent Compact

The School-Parent Compact is a committment from the school, the parent, and the student to share in the responsibility for improved academic achievement.  You, as a Title I parent, have the right to be involved in the development of the School-Parent Compact. 

 The School-Parent Compact was sent home with your child's Title I eligibility letter in August.

Parental Involvement Needs Assessment

The Parental Involvement Needs Assessment is sent home at the end of August each year to Title I parents.  The assessment is used to help plan workshops and meetings based on parents' needs.

Attestation

An attestation is a signed statement by the principal at a Title I school attesting that all teachers at their school are highly qualified and teaching in the appropriate field.

Title I Disclaimer

The Title I Disclaimer is the form Title I parents can complete if they choose to have their child removed from the Title I program.

Parents Right To Know

The "Parents Right to Know" letter was sent home at the end of August to every Title I parent.  You, as a Title I parent, have the right to request the qualifications of your child's teachers.
